Define the Working of Spring Cylinder?

One part of a cylinder is filled by one mole of a monatomic ideal gas at a pressure of 1 atm and temperature of 300 K. A massless piston splits the gas from the other section of the cylinder which is evacuated but has a spring at equilibrium extension attached to it and to the opposite wall of the cylinder.

The cylinder is thermally insulated as of the rest of the world, and the piston is fixed to the cylinder primarily and then released.  Later than reaching equilibrium, the volume engaged by the gas is double the original. Abandoning the thermal capacities of the piston, cylinder, and spring, finds the temperature and pressure of the gas.
